Roving destined for the loom has a different problem from roving that gets chopped. It has to bend, repeatedly and sharply, over the heald and through the reed, without the strand splitting or the filaments breaking. Flexibility is the specification.

COIM publishes two properties for this family: good flexibility and quick styrene solubility.

Two grades are published. FILCO 352 is the bisphenolic polyester at 40 percent solids in partially anionic dispersion, and it is shared with the panel roving family. FILCO 355 is the epoxy ester at 43 percent solids in non-ionic dispersion, with an EEW of 3000, which is the highest in the whole FILCO range.

A 3000 g/eq epoxy ester is a long chain, which is what makes the FILCO 355 film flexible.

Handling and dispersion

Applied at the forming line in a sizing bath. On weaving work the sizing has to be judged on the loom, because breakage rate is the number that matters and it does not show up in a bench test.

FILCO 352 runs in partially anionic dispersion and FILCO 355 in non-ionic. That difference matters to bath compatibility if you are blending with other components, so name the full size formulation when you ask.

Why does a weaving sizing need flexibility?

The strand bends sharply and repeatedly through the heald and the reed. A stiff film splits the strand and breaks filaments, and the breakage rate on the loom is what decides whether the sizing works. Flexibility is the first property COIM lists for this family.

Why is FILCO 355 at 3000 g/eq when the direct roving epoxies are at 200?

EEW tracks chain length. A 3000 g/eq epoxy ester is a long chain, and long chains give a flexible film. The 200 g/eq direct roving grades are short chains, which give a soft film that dissolves fast.

FILCO 352 also appears on the panel roving page. Is it the same grade?

Yes, the same grade published for two applications. On panel roving COIM notes it is to be used with plasticizer; here it is published on its own for weaving. Tell us the application and we will confirm the full specification.
